[發(fā)明專利]一種穿越單邊防火墻建立TCP連接的方法及裝置有效
| 申請?zhí)枺?/td> | 201210468352.0 | 申請日: | 2012-11-19 |
| 公開(公告)號(hào): | CN102970291A | 公開(公告)日: | 2013-03-13 |
| 發(fā)明(設(shè)計(jì))人: | 官元峰 | 申請(專利權(quán))人: | 北京思特奇信息技術(shù)股份有限公司 |
| 主分類號(hào): | H04L29/06 | 分類號(hào): | H04L29/06;H04L12/851 |
| 代理公司: | 北京輕創(chuàng)知識(shí)產(chǎn)權(quán)代理有限公司 11212 | 代理人: | 楊立 |
| 地址: | 100086 北京市海淀*** | 國省代碼: | 北京;11 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 穿越 單邊 防火墻 建立 tcp 連接 方法 裝置 | ||
1.一種穿越單邊防火墻建立TCP連接的方法,其特征在于,包括以下步驟:
步驟1:分別在同一局域網(wǎng)內(nèi)部低優(yōu)先級服務(wù)器和高優(yōu)先級服務(wù)器上運(yùn)行代理程序分別建立第一代理客戶端和第二代理客戶端;
步驟2:在第一代理客戶端和第二代理客戶端之間建立消息連接(Lm);
步驟3:在客戶端與第一代理客戶端的空閑端口之間建立第一數(shù)據(jù)連接(L1);
步驟4:第一代理客戶端通過消息連接(Lm)向第二代理客戶端發(fā)送通知;
步驟5:第二代理客戶端接收到通知后,分別向第一代理客戶端和局域網(wǎng)外部的服務(wù)器建立第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3);
步驟6:從客戶端到服務(wù)器,經(jīng)過第一數(shù)據(jù)連接(L1),第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3)進(jìn)行雙向數(shù)據(jù)的轉(zhuǎn)發(fā)。
2.根據(jù)權(quán)利要求1所述的穿越單邊防火墻建立TCP連接的方法,其特征在于:所述第一數(shù)據(jù)連接(L1),第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L?3)為TCP連接。
3.根據(jù)權(quán)利要求1所述的穿越單邊防火墻建立TCP連接的方法,其特征在于:所述消息連接(Lm)通過包頭數(shù)據(jù)進(jìn)行標(biāo)識(shí)。
4.根據(jù)權(quán)利要求1所述的穿越單邊防火墻建立TCP連接的方法,其特征在于:在進(jìn)行所述步驟5中雙向數(shù)據(jù)的轉(zhuǎn)發(fā)時(shí),所述第一數(shù)據(jù)連接(L1),第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3)均作為數(shù)據(jù)的透明傳輸層,并不處理轉(zhuǎn)發(fā)的數(shù)據(jù)。
5.一種穿越單邊防火墻建立TCP連接的裝置,其特征在于:包括建立代理模塊(1),建立消息連接模塊(2),單向連接模塊(3),通知模塊(4),雙向連接模塊(5)和數(shù)據(jù)轉(zhuǎn)發(fā)模塊(6);
建立代理模塊(1),分別在同一局域網(wǎng)內(nèi)部低優(yōu)先級服務(wù)器和高優(yōu)先級服務(wù)器上運(yùn)行代理程序分別建立第一代理客戶端和第二代理客戶端;
建立消息連接模塊(2),在第一代理客戶端和第二的代理之間建立消息連接(Lm);
單向連接模塊(3),在客戶端與第一代理客戶端的空閑端口之間建立第一數(shù)據(jù)連接(L1);
通知模塊(4),第一代理客戶端通過消息連接(Lm)向第二代理客戶端發(fā)送通知;
雙向連接模塊(5),第二代理客戶端接收到通知后,分別向第一代理客戶端和局域網(wǎng)外部的服務(wù)器建立第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3);
數(shù)據(jù)轉(zhuǎn)發(fā)模塊(6),從客戶端到服務(wù)器,經(jīng)過第一數(shù)據(jù)連接(L1),第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3),進(jìn)行雙向數(shù)據(jù)的轉(zhuǎn)發(fā)。
6.根據(jù)權(quán)利要求5所述的穿越單邊防火墻建立TCP連接的裝置,其特征在于:所述單向模塊(3)建立的第一數(shù)據(jù)連接(L1)、雙向連接模塊建立的第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3)均為TCP連接。
7.根據(jù)權(quán)利要求5所述的穿越單邊防火墻建立TCP連接的裝置,其特征在于:所述建立消息連接模塊(2)建立的消息連接(Lm),通過包頭數(shù)據(jù)進(jìn)行標(biāo)識(shí)。
8.根據(jù)權(quán)利要求5所述的穿越單邊防火墻建立TCP連接的裝置,其特征在于:所述數(shù)據(jù)轉(zhuǎn)發(fā)模塊(6)進(jìn)行雙向數(shù)據(jù)的轉(zhuǎn)發(fā)時(shí),所述第一數(shù)據(jù)連接(L1),第二數(shù)據(jù)連接(L2)和第三數(shù)據(jù)連接(L3)均作為數(shù)據(jù)的透明傳輸層,并不處理轉(zhuǎn)發(fā)的數(shù)據(jù)。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于北京思特奇信息技術(shù)股份有限公司,未經(jīng)北京思特奇信息技術(shù)股份有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201210468352.0/1.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。





